Redstone Ore Not Powering

Well I was playing minecraft, and I was going in my creative world checking out the new features/bug fixes in the new Snapshot, and when I step on redstone ore, it doesn't give out redstone power. This was tested in survival too.

Redstone ore never gives off redstone power.

Strange, in other versions it did, I stepped on it and it lit up and made power, great for the Colored Pressure plates.

The Minecraft Wiki says it does, and has for quite a while

Redstone ore can also become powered by a mob in contact with it. This can be used as a substitute for pressure plates

In the talk page of that article it also says:

Redstone ore is incapable of providing power to any circuits, regardless of the circumstances. The only way to use redstone ore to produce a current is with a toggleable BUD switch. The section on the page about redstone ore should be removed or heavily updated.

But if you can find a version where activated redstone ore does provide redstone power, this can be reopened. To my knowledge there is none.
